Default New Clutch, New Problems.

ok so about 2,000 miles ago I did a monster stg 3 clutch swap, new flywheel, new PP, tick perf. T-56 lvl 2 re-build, new pilot bearing, new T/O bearing and new slave cyl. The car nows seems to slightly grind in 1-4th gears. I can release the clutch slowly and stop the grind sometimes. Also after a long drive the other day, I have an issue where I pushed the clutch in to change the gears and as I moved the shifter, it grinded as almost the clutch wasn't even engaged ( has happend twice ). Anyways it's pretty much a small grind as soon as I release the clutch after every gear change. The only thing that wasn't changed during my upgrade was the Master Cyl. I have a Tick one in the garage. Thanks to blueknights new video, I'll be installing it soon. Also when the clutch is out, it makes the funny noise as if my T/O bearing is bad ( the rattle )... Video posted below is a good example of that sound. So do you guys think just changing the Master Cyl. will fix all these issues? also what exactly is clutch chatter?

So tonite I took the TA out and was on the freeway, just cruising. I went to downshift from 6th to 5th and when I went to go push in the clutch, the pedal fell to the floor. I tried to pull the pedal back to life with my foot several times, but no luck. Something sounded like it was getting thrown around and hit in the bellhousing so I jerked it into neutral. even with the car in neutral, when I release the clutch it goes to banging again so I had to hold the clutch in. I don't get it, Hold the clutch in while its in neutral just to keep it from going nuts inside that bellhousing... I cut the car off ( tried to let clutch/flywheel cool ). tried it again, hard as hell to get it into ANY gear BUT reverse. finally after playing with it. It would try to drive in 1st and such but after releasing the clutch, it goes to banging and slapping again so I had to hold the clutch in and keep the car running so my battery wouldn't die and the tow truck can see my lights on...$175 tow!

I dunno what the **** happend. I double/trippled/quaddroople checked everything 2K miles ago when I did the swap. I am almost 100% certain I did everything right... I'm still stumped on what happend. More or less, looks like the damn transmission has gotta come out again...****...
